Sensemaker, an evolving toolkit developed by Jigsaw, helps make sense of large-scale online conversations, leveraging LLMs to categorize statements, and summarize statements and voting patterns to surface actionable insights.

There are currently three main functions: ▪ Topic Identification - identifies the main points of discussion. The level of detail is configurable, allowing the tool to discover: just the top level topics; topics and subtopics; or the deepest level — topics, subtopics, and themes (sub-subtopics). ▪ Statement Categorization - sorts statements into topics defined by a user or from the Topic Identification function. Statements can belong to more than one topic. ▪ Summarization - analyzes statements and vote data to output a summary of the conversation, including an overview, themes discussed, and areas of agreement and disagreement.
